BP Suspends Offshore Platform in Azerbaijan for 25-day Maintenance

British oil company BP will suspend its Chirag platform in Azerbaijan on Sept. 23 for planned maintenance that will last for 25 days, BP Azerbaijan said on Thursday.

The oil major uses the Chirag platform to produce oil at the Azeri-Chirag-Guneshli (ACG) fields in the Caspian Sea.

"This is a routine, planned program and is part of normal operations," the company said.
